St. John and St. Paul squared off in some playoff action on Thursday, but St. John had to settle for second. They lost 3-0 to the St. Paul Flyers. The Fighting Herald's loss signaled the end of their 25-game winning streak.
The match finished with set scores of 25-16, 25-17, 25-17.
Despite the loss, St. John still got an impressive performance from Alexa Jordan, who had 19 digs and two aces. Jordan has been hot recently, having posted 12 or more digs the last three times she's played.
Having lost for the first time this season, St. John fell to 25-1. As for St. Paul, they have been performing incredibly well recently as they've won eight of their last nine matchups, which provided a nice bump to their 19-7 record this season.
St. John does not have any more games scheduled as of now. As for St. Paul, they did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next game, a 3-0 victory against Wellsville on the 2nd.
